5418447d2952b4c55c3f103058891ce477bd575b
People Randomizr
Application Next.js pour extraire aléatoirement un certain nombre de personnes à partir d'un fichier CSV.
Installation
npm install
Développement
npm run dev
Ouvrez http://localhost:3000 dans votre navigateur.
Fonctionnalités
- Affichage de toutes les personnes du CSV
- Extraction aléatoire d'un nombre configurable de personnes
- Affichage des résultats avec nom, description et type
Structure
app/page.tsx- Page principale avec l'interface utilisateurapp/api/people/route.ts- API route pour charger les données du CSVlib/csv-parser.ts- Parser pour le fichier CSVgroup-dev-ad.csv- Fichier source des données
Description
Languages
TypeScript
87.4%
CSS
6.8%
Dockerfile
5.1%
JavaScript
0.7%